Output 0808876fc9206702bf44fc89536ea2f644d63353d56a71f208e9a44ba142100e:61

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d0fc5d83d8bcda13f63e223b515256e45a4e42701c47c12ebab5e78402cbd63
address
bc1pm58utkpa30x6z0mrug3m29f9dez6fep8q8z8cyht4d08sspvh43srpa494
transaction
0808876fc9206702bf44fc89536ea2f644d63353d56a71f208e9a44ba142100e
spent
true